Weingut Keller

The Keller estate is located in the small town of Flörsheim-Dalsheim in the Rheinhessen wine growing region of Germany and it has been in the family for over 220 years. Many vines were planted in the 50’s and 60’s. Dual vignerons, Klaus-Peter and his wife Julia turn conventional wisdom upside down by slowing photosynthesis to achieve a long, slow ripening period. In constant pursuit of making the sublime more sublime from one vintage to the next, Klaus-Peter’s perfectionism in the vineyard and winery is rivalled by few in Germany; his personal intensity and the quality of his vineyards are almost unparalleled. Keller clearly practices some of the lowest yields in Germany these days for Rieslings, with the entire estate averaging about thirty-five hectolitres per hectare. These are crop levels in line with the philosophy of Egon Muller, but out of step with virtually every other top estate in Germany.
